Job Description
West Dunbartonshire Council is looking to recruit a Members Secretary to provide a high level, confidential secretarial and administrative service to the Elected Members of the Council.
We are looking for someone with excellent administrative skills, who is highly organised and proactive. The post holder should be able to strive to overcome problems through collaborative working and use their own initiative to deal with complex, confidential and sensitive issues in the absence of the Senior Democratic Services Officer. You must also be a highly effective communicator and be able to make informed decisions to ensure that tasks are progressed and prioritise conflicting demands.
Applicants must have an HNC/SVQ3 in a relevant discipline or equivalent relevant experience.
This role is suitable for hybrid working however this would be discussed/agreed in line with office cover.
